SUMMARY:On the Single-Source Unsplittable Flow Problem
DESCRIPTION:Speaker: Soumyadeep Paul (TIFR)\n\nAbstract: \nThe single-sourc
 e unsplittable flow problem deals with a graph $G$\, source single source 
 $s$ and $k$ terminals for $k$ commodities. We want to find a flow such tha
 t each commodity is routed along exactly one path. I will be presenting th
 e main algorithm that shows how to get an unsplittable flow such that the 
 flow across an edge is violated by at most the maximum demand\, assuming a
  feasible flow exists. In graphs which satisfy that the maximum demand is 
 less than the minimum capacity and a feasible flow exists\, we will see ho
 w to get a flow of congestion at most 2\, that all demands can be satisfie
 d as a union of 5 unsplittable flows and that 22.6% of the total demand ca
 n be satisfied unsplittably.\nBased on the following paper: https://link.
